last postcard from france

Here I am in Charles De Gaulle airport on my way home. Left Montpellier last night and spent the night here in the airport observing homeless people who seem to live here. Paid 9 euro to have wifi for 24 hours which has been super nice to help the time go by. At one point a homeless guy set up his whole kitchen on the little desk next to me and started cooking on a hot pot or something...very strange.
I am feeling quite sleep deprived....on about hour 26 right now...but still feeling good. My last days in Ganges were wonderful. Rebecca came down from London on Friday. We went right away to the beach and a crazy little town called Grand Motte where all the buildings are built in a very strange Jetons/Miami style......lots of glammy boats. I am sure the town is hopping in the summer.
That night met Che and a work friend of his in town, drink on the square and then dinner at a lovely little place, then more drinks (of course). Saturday we went to St. Guillem Le Desert, a beautiful little town not far from Ganges. We hiked up to the ridge above it where there are ruins of an old castle. We were the only ones in it....beautiful view. Home, and a lovely dinner, many bottles of wine and a scrabble game that I didn't fare so well in (wine's fault)....to bed at 4 then sleep till noon. A wonderful Sunday....french toast and mimosas, then a long, lazy walk from the house.
Monday Rebecca and I went into work with Che then took the tram into town for a bit of shopping and a beautiful lunch sitting outside in the sun. Took Rebecca to the airport then back to the beaches till it was time to get Che and a ride to the airport....such a beautiful end to my trip.
Thank you France....i'll b back.....bisous.
